GAS SEPARATION COMPOSITE MEMBRANE AND METHOD OF PRODUCING THE SAME, AND GAS SEPARATING MODULE, GAS SEPARATION APPARATUS AND GAS SEPARATION METHOD USING THE SAME
申请人:FUJIFILM Corporation
公开号:US20140130667A1
公开(公告)日:2014-05-15
A gas separation composite membrane, containing a gas-permeable supporting layer and a gas separating layer containing a crosslinked polyimide resin over the gas-permeable supporting layer, in which the crosslinked polyimide resin is formed by a polyimide compound being crosslinked by a radically crosslinkable functional group thereof, and a ratio [η] of a crosslinked site to an imide group of the polyimide compound (the number of crosslinked sites/the number of imide groups) in the crosslinked polyimide resin is 0.0001 or more and 0.45 or less; a method of producing the same; and a gas separating module, a gas separation apparatus and a gas separation method using the same.
GAS SEPARATION COMPOSITE MEMBRANE, METHOD OF PRODUCING THE SAME, GAS SEPARATING MODULE USING THE SAME, AND GAS SEPARATION APPARATUS AND GAS SEPARATION METHOD
申请人:FUJIFILM CORPORATION
公开号:US20140352534A1
公开(公告)日:2014-12-04
A gas separation composite membrane, containing: a gas-permeable supporting layer; and a gas separating layer containing a crosslinked polyimide resin, over the gas-permeable supporting layer, in which the crosslinked polyimide resin is composed of a polyimide compound having been crosslinked through an ester linking group, in which the polyimide compound contains a repeating unit of formula (I), a repeating unit of formula (II-a) or (II-b), and a repeating unit of formula (III-a) or (III-b), and in which a ratio [κ] of a site forming a crosslinked chain mediated by the ester linking group to an imide group (the number of specific crosslinkable sites/the number of imide groups) is more than 0.4 and less than 0.5.
